Transaction 20dbbe9018a1190a0cf03e570872561f7c5e91c4df234208a14b6e3bb25a824d
1 Input
1 Output
-
20dbbe9018a1190a0cf03e570872561f7c5e91c4df234208a14b6e3bb25a824d:0
- value
- 620343
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e519d9aefebb1ef140279032e07410fcf533c28 OP_EQUAL
- address
- 32zj9z1t8YTdyDXM9oGBuYNeDm4tQaruQ1